Your home may benefit from radiant heat installation if you notice uneven heating across different rooms, with some areas feeling too warm while others stay cold. Drafts near windows and doors often signal that forced-air systems struggle to maintain consistent temperatures in older Campbell County homes. If your current heating bills keep climbing despite setting the thermostat lower, an inefficient system may be working harder than necessary. Allergy sufferers in your household might benefit from radiant heat since it does not blow dust and allergens around like conventional systems do. Rooms that stay cold even when the thermostat reads the right temperature point to ductwork problems or undersized heating equipment. If you are planning a home addition or renovation, now is the ideal time to consider radiant heat installation for those new spaces.

Our process begins with a thorough evaluation of your home’s layout, insulation, and existing infrastructure to determine the best radiant heat approach for your situation. We offer three main types of radiant heat installation: hydronic systems that circulate hot water through tubes beneath your floors, electric mat systems ideal for targeted heating in bathrooms or kitchens, and air-heated systems less commonly used in residential applications. During installation, our technicians carefully plan the layout to ensure even heat distribution across every room, paying special attention to areas that typically stay colder like bathrooms and rooms over unheated spaces. For hydronic systems, we install a high-efficiency boiler or water heater as the heat source, connect it to a network of PEX tubing secured beneath your subfloor or embedded in concrete slabs, and integrate smart controls that allow you to set temperatures by room. Radiant heat installation serves Campbell County homes particularly well given the region’s seasonal temperature fluctuations and varied housing styles. The uneven terrain around LaFollette and surrounding communities means some homes sit on slopes or have crawl spaces where traditional ductwork performs poorly—radiant systems eliminate these problem areas entirely. Older homes with high ceilings in Caryville lose significant heat through the upper portions of living spaces when using forced-air systems, but radiant heat warms from the floor up where you actually live. New construction projects in the area benefit from radiant heat installation during the building phase, allowing contractors to embed tubing directly into foundations for maximum efficiency. The fuel source you choose affects operating costs, and many homeowners compare furnace installation costs with radiant systems to find the right balance between upfront investment and monthly heating expenses. If your current heating system is aging and inefficient, a heating system replacement with radiant heat may provide better long-term value than repeated repairs on an outdated forced-air system.
Electric furnace systems represent an excellent heating solution for homes throughout Campbell County, particularly in areas where natural gas lines aren’t readily available. Many properties in the rural sections around Caryville and LaFollette, Jacksboro, Caryville, and Campbell County TN benefit from electric heating due to the region’s reliable electrical infrastructure and the absence of gas service in remote locations.
These systems offer several distinct advantages for East Tennessee homeowners, including clean operation without combustion byproducts, minimal maintenance requirements, and precise temperature control. Electric furnaces are especially suitable for well-insulated homes and can be paired with programmable thermostats to maximize energy efficiency during the region’s variable weather patterns. The installation process is typically less complex than gas systems, as it doesn’t require gas line connections or extensive venting modifications.

Heat pump technology offers Campbell County homeowners an innovative approach to year-round climate control, providing both heating and cooling through a single, energy-efficient system. These versatile units work exceptionally well in East Tennessee’s moderate climate, where temperatures rarely reach extremes that challenge heat pump performance, making them ideal for the rolling terrain around Caryville and the valleys near LaFollette, Jacksboro, Caryville, and Campbell County TN.
Unlike traditional heating systems that generate heat through combustion or electrical resistance, heat pumps transfer thermal energy from outside air, delivering up to three times more heating energy than they consume in electricity. This efficiency advantage becomes particularly valuable during the region’s mild winter months, when heat pumps operate at peak performance levels while maintaining comfortable indoor temperatures throughout your home.

High-efficiency furnace installation delivers exceptional value for Campbell County homeowners seeking maximum comfort while minimizing energy costs and environmental impact. These advanced systems achieve Annual Fuel Utilization Efficiency (AFUE) ratings of 90% or higher, representing a substantial improvement over older furnaces that typically operate at 60-80% efficiency levels common in homes throughout the LaFollette and LaFollette, Jacksboro, Caryville, and Campbell County TN areas.
Advanced features like variable-speed blowers, two-stage gas valves, and modulating burner systems allow high-efficiency furnaces to adapt precisely to your home’s heating demands, eliminating the temperature swings and energy waste associated with older single-stage systems. These technologies prove particularly beneficial in East Tennessee’s variable climate, where heating demands can change rapidly based on weather conditions and time of day.
The installation process requires careful attention to venting requirements, as high-efficiency units produce cooler exhaust gases that may require different venting materials and configurations than conventional furnaces. A properly sized unit cools every room evenly, avoiding hot spots and cold drafts throughout your home.
When your AC matches your home’s square footage and insulation, it doesn’t need to overwork, helping you save on energy costs.
Oversized systems cycle on and off too often, while undersized ones run constantly. Both lead to faster wear and tear.
Correctly sized units remove humidity effectively, keeping your indoor air more comfortable during LaFollette, Jacksboro, Caryville, and Campbell County TN’s humid summers.
Proper sizing means less strain on the compressor and other key components, minimizing breakdowns and repair costs.
